A significant regulatory milestone has been reached for MannKind Corporation following its acquisition of scPharmaceuticals. The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has formally accepted for review an application for a new, patient-friendly delivery method of the heart failure drug FUROSCIX. This development represents a pivotal moment for the asset now under MannKind's umbrella.
The agency will review a Supplemental New Drug Application (sNDA) for the FUROSCIX ReadyFlow™ Autoinjector, officially initiating the evaluation process. A target decision date of July 26, 2026, has been set by the regulator.
The potential approval of the autoinjector promises a dramatic shift in how patients receive treatment. The currently approved FUROSCIX infusion pump requires an administration period of approximately five hours. In stark contrast, the ReadyFlow system is designed to deliver the injection in under ten seconds. This innovation could offer adults suffering from chronic heart failure or kidney disease a far more convenient option for managing fluid overload at home, potentially reducing the need for hospital admissions.

The Acquisition's Foundation and Financials
This progress stems from MannKind's complete takeover of scPharmaceuticals, finalized on October 7, 2025. The transaction involved MannKind purchasing all outstanding shares for $5.35 per share in cash. Additionally, scPharmaceuticals shareholders received a non-tradeable Contingent Value Right (CVR), which could pay up to an additional $1.00 per share upon achieving specific regulatory and commercial milestones. scPharmaceuticals stock ceased trading upon the deal's completion.
Prior to the acquisition, scPharmaceuticals reported second-quarter 2025 net revenue for FUROSCIX of $16.0 million—a 99 percent increase compared to the same period the previous year. Despite this revenue growth, the company recorded a quarterly net loss of $18.0 million.
The next definitive checkpoint for the FUROSCIX portfolio is the FDA's July 26, 2026, decision deadline. Securing approval for the autoinjector would bolster MannKind's product offerings and reinforce its strategic expansion into the cardiometabolic disease sector.
